Bluebird Bio is asking stockholders to vote for a reverse stock split to maintain Nasdaq compliance and enable future financing, crucial for reaching cash flow breakeven in the second half of 2025.
Bluebird Bio adjourned its annual meeting to solicit additional votes for a reverse stock split proposal aimed at maintaining Nasdaq listing and securing future financing.
Bluebird Bio is urging its stockholders to vote in favor of a reverse stock split to regain compliance with Nasdaq's minimum bid price requirement and enable the company to raise additional capital.
Bluebird Bio is urging stockholders to vote in favor of Proposals 4 and 5, including a reverse stock split and an amendment to the incentive award plan, at the Annual Meeting of Stockholders on November 6, 2024.
Bluebird Bio is addressing a potential delisting from the Nasdaq Global Select Market due to its stock price falling below the minimum bid price requirement and is considering a reverse stock split.
Bluebird Bio has filed a definitive proxy statement with the SEC, indicating upcoming shareholder meetings and voting on key corporate matters.
Bluebird Bio is asking stockholders to vote on proposals including officer exculpation, a reverse stock split, and amendments to its incentive award plan at the upcoming annual meeting.
